Geographical Distribution
http://www.who.int/emc-documents/surveillance/docs/whocdscsrisr2001.html
14 million cases (2 million new cases each year), distributed in 88 countries (350 million people at risk).

Clinical syndromes
Cutaneous leishmaniasis – L. braziliensis, L. amazonensis, L.
guyanensisL. major
Diffuse leishmaniasis – L. amazonensis
Mucocutaneous leishmaniasis – L. braziliensis
Visceral leishmaniasis – L. chagasi, L. donovani
New World species Old World species

Characterisation of the meta 1 gene in L. major
- 12 kDa, pI 9.7
- expressed in promastigotes, upregulated in
metacyclics
- localises to vacuoles close to the
flagellar pocket
- conserved in all Leishmania
species

META domain: Small domain family found in proteins of of unknown function. Some are secreted and implicated in motility in bacteria. Also occurs in Leishmania spp. as an essential gene. Over-expression in L.amazonensis increases virulence. A pair of cysteine residues show correlated conservation, suggesting that they form a disulphide bond. Taxa: cellular organisms

Conclusions
• Meta 1 and meta 2 genes- conserved in Leishmania, synteny with Trypanosoma
• Meta 1 related to virulence; Meta 2 ?
• Meta genes: several copies in Trypanosoma – evaluate function in T. brucei (RNAi)
• Meta 2 protein: Calcium? regulation of calpain activity?
• Meta locus: other stage-regulated genes - virulence ?
